Narrative:
Flew into high ground in cloudy conditions during navigation exercise, at Clagh Ouyr, North Barrule, near Ramsey, Isle of Man

Both crew - Flight Lieutenant Roger Francis Lane and Flight Lieutenant Julian Mark Baden Lewis - did not eject, and were killed on impact with the ground. The pair took off at about 10:20, shortly after while flying in light cloud the aircraft struck Clagh Ouyr and broke up over a wide area killing the two crew instantly.
